  9. Old Dominion University is a public institution that was founded in 1930.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 18,375 (fall 2022), its setting is city, and the campus size is 251 acres.

  10. Old Dominion University guarantees admission to applicants completing a transfer-oriented degree program or an articulated applied associate degree program at a Virginia community college (VCCS) with a cumulative grade point average (GPA) of 2.5 or higher on a four-point scale.
